FAMILY RECORDS DATABASE:
A supplementary database currently containing records of marriages and deaths/burials, from our own copies of local transcriptions, often with additional information to that which is currently available elsewhere. Our burials database is even searchable by grave number (where grave numbers have been recorded) meaning you can now identify all those individuals who were laid to rest in the same grave. Whenever possible, our records of marriages contain details of both the bride and grooms father and his occupation and in some cases the names of witnesses to the marriage. Our memorial inscriptions have either been recorded by ourselves, (and where possible they include photographs taken by us at the time of transcription), or from the transcriptions made over recent years by local enthusiast Ron Gosney.
